接上篇:
tomcat有了, war包有了, 现在需要把 war包部署到 tomcat里面去了
ZXIAOYU-M-338S:apache-tomcat-9.0.0.M6 test$ cp /Users/test/sazhuo/websocketServer/target/websocketServer.war webapps/
ZXIAOYU-M-338S:apache-tomcat-9.0.0.M6 test$ cd bin/
ZXIAOYU-M-338S:bin test$ ./startup.sh
Using CATALINA_BASE: /Users/test/sazhuo/apache-tomcat-9.0.0.M6
Using CATALINA_HOME: /Users/test/sazhuo/apache-tomcat-9.0.0.M6
Using CATALINA_TMPDIR: /Users/test/sazhuo/apache-tomcat-9.0.0.M6/temp
Using JRE_HOME: /Library/Java/JavaVirtualMachines/Home
Using CLASSPATH: /Users/test/sazhuo/apache-tomcat-9.0.0.M6/bin/bootstrap.jar:/Users/test/sazhuo/apache-tomcat-9.0.0.M6/bin/tomcat-juli.jar
touch: /Users/test/sazhuo/apache-tomcat-9.0.0.M6/logs/catalina.out: Permission denied
/Users/test/sazhuo/apache-tomcat-9.0.0.M6/bin/catalina.sh: line 411: /Users/test/sazhuo/apache-tomcat-9.0.0.M6/logs/catalina.out: Permission denied
ZXIAOYU-M-338S:bin test$ sudo chmod 755 catalina.out
Password:
chmod: catalina.out: No such file or directory
ZXIAOYU-M-338S:bin test$ ps -A |grep java
8859 ttys002 0:00.01 grep java
5748 ttys003 0:13.46 /Library/Java/JavaVirtualMachines/Home/bin/java -Djava.util.logging.config.file=/Users/test/sazhuo/apache-tomcat-9.0.0.M6/conf/logging.properties -Djava.util.logging.manager=org.apache.juli.ClassLoaderLogManager -Djdk.tls.ephemeralDHKeySize=2048 -classpath /Users/test/sazhuo/apache-tomcat-9.0.0.M6/bin/bootstrap.jar:/Users/test/sazhuo/apache-tomcat-9.0.0.M6/bin/tomcat-juli.jar -Dcatalina.base=/Users/test/sazhuo/apache-tomcat-9.0.0.M6 -Dcatalina.home=/Users/test/sazhuo/apache-tomcat-9.0.0.M6 -Djava.io.tmpdir=/Users/test/sazhuo/apache-tomcat-9.0.0.M6/temp org.apache.catalina.startup.Bootstrap start
ZXIAOYU-M-338S:bin test$ kill 5748
-bash: kill: (5748) - Operation not permitted
ZXIAOYU-M-338S:bin test$ sudo kill 5748
Password:
ZXIAOYU-M-338S:bin test$ cd ..
ZXIAOYU-M-338S:apache-tomcat-9.0.0.M6 test$ ls webapps/
ROOT docs examples host-manager manager websocketServer websocketServer.war
ZXIAOYU-M-338S:apache-tomcat-9.0.0.M6 test$ bin/startup.sh //启动tomcat
Using CATALINA_BASE: /Users/te